Long Talk: Mr. Davy

June 5, 2020

What is your position at ISB and how many years have you been here?

This is my ninth year at ISB. My current position is a High School Counselor. In High School, we have two different types of Counselors under the Counselling team. A High School Counselor which is a personal and social counselor and a College Counselor that really focuses on the university application support. So, I have been in this position as a High School counselor 3-4 years, and before that, I was the ninth-graders’ counselor. So, I think for 3 years I looked after all of the ninth graders’ transition from middle school to high school. I took care of all ninth graders’ that have come through. Before that, for two years in ISB, I was the middle school counselor. So, I have had three different positions at ISB. 

 What is the next destination in your life?

It is going to be Switzerland. I am going to be working at another ISB – International School Basel. It is very close to Germany, about a 15-minute drive to Germany and a 15-minute drive to France. It is very close to the German and French borders. I am going to be an HS counselor there as well. 

Why did you decide to go there?

Good question! A number of reasons. First of all, I wanted to have a new experience for myself and my family and I wanted to grow professionally. It’s always good to try different places. Also, to be just a little bit closer to my family which is in the UK. It is only an hour’s flight to see my mum and dad. Also, my girls when they moved here were only 2 and 4 so Thailand is all that they have known. It’s been a wonderful experience but it would be good to give them a different experience now.
